Derek Jeter’s country house castle is up for grabs.
The formerNew York Yankeesplayer’s lakefront mansion is located about 45-miles northwest of Manhattan. The 4-acre estate is known to locals as Tiedemann Castle and is comprised of several homes on the same property,Varietyreports.
Listed for $14.75 millionthrough Diane Mitchell with Wright Bros. Real Estate, Jeter’s abode contains multiple buildings with at leasteight bedroomsand 12 bathrooms, totaling nearly 13,000 square feet of indoor space between them.

Inside the three-story main house, which was built in the early 1900s, there are six bedrooms, including two master suites. The home also features a study, an office, and multiple dining areas, formal living rooms, sitting areas, and alarge kitchenwith a fireplace.

The bottom floor of the castle also features a game room and its own dining room, in addition to a large family room with an attached kitchen and terrace.

In total, the home features four kitchens inside and one outside. The grounds include asprawling lawnwith an infinity pool, a pool house, wet bar, basketball court, guesthouse, lagoon, boat house, turret, and a replica of the Statue of Liberty overlooking the lake.
